Understanding Non-UK Regulated Casinos
Non-UK regulated casinos operate outside the jurisdiction of the UK Gambling Commission. These establishments can be based in various countries, often in regions known for their more lenient gambling laws, such as Curacao, Malta, and Gibraltar. While these casinos provide many attractive features, such as a broader range of games and bonuses, they also come with specific risks that players need to understand.

Disadvantages to Consider
While the benefits can be enticing, there are notable downsides to consider when playing at non-UK regulated casinos.
1. Lack of Consumer Protection: Without the oversight of the UK Gambling Commission, players may find themselves without the same level of consumer protection. Issues such as delayed payments or unfair practices may arise.

2. Risk of Fraud: Some non-UK regulated casinos might not be trustworthy. It’s essential to conduct thorough research and read reviews before engaging with any platform to ensure its legitimacy.
3. Limited Support: Customer support at non-UK casinos may not be as robust, and players might find it challenging to get assistance regarding their accounts or disputes with the casino.
4. Taxes on Winnings: Depending on the player’s jurisdiction and the laws in the casino’s country, winnings may be subject to tax, complicating the gambling experience.
